We are on our 3rd brood of hens. Currently, our Wyndote has a prolapsed vent and, possibly, gleet. I have been treating her with bathes daily, massaging out crusties, using homey on her vent and then applying witchhazel around the vent to help keep her insides inside. Have her in our basement in a darkened crate. Looking for advice of what to feed her to keep her from laying and how to treat her. We are on day 2.
